There has been a similar debate in Norway. According to law the public should have free access to databases that is founded in companies that are own by the public.

Companies with a monopoly or companies that have a political purpose and is founded by the public would also be covered by the law of free access to databases.

The company responsible for departure information in Oslo was very early with open APIs and giving access to developers. Only clausal was that you couldn't use it for commercial work. A couple of months ago they also removed this clausal so now it's free, even for commercial usage. More info here: http://bit.ly/iq1pbT (google translate)
